On Fri, Feb 06, 2026 at 03:08:21PM +0200, Antoniu Miclaus wrote:
> Add support for AD4082 20-bit SAR ADC. The AD4082 has the same
> resolution as AD4080 (20-bit) but differs in LVDS CNV clock count
> maximum (8 vs 7).

> Changes:
> - Add AD4082_CHIP_ID definition (0x0052)
> - Create ad4082_channel with 20-bit resolution and 32-bit storage
> - Add ad4082_chip_info with lvds_cnv_clk_cnt_max = 8
> - Register AD4082 in device ID and OF match tables

TBH, I think this section is too much for the commit message...

> Signed-off-by: Antoniu Miclaus <antoniu.miclaus@analog.com>
> ---

...and just as good to be placed here.

Otherwise, LGTM,
Reviewed-by: Andy Shevchenko <andriy.shevchenko@intel.com>
